package Moose::Util;
use strict;
use warnings;
use Sub::Exporter;
use Scalar::Util 'blessed';
use Carp 'confess';
use Class::MOP 0.56;
our $VERSION = '0.54';
our $AUTHORITY = 'cpan:STEVAN';
my @exports = qw[
find_meta
does_role
search_class_by_role
apply_all_roles
get_all_init_args
get_all_attribute_values
resolve_metatrait_alias
resolve_metaclass_alias
add_method_modifier
];
Sub::Exporter::setup_exporter({
exports => \@exports,
groups => { all => \@exports }
});
## some utils for the utils ...
sub find_meta {
return unless $_[0];
return Class::MOP::get_metaclass_by_name(blessed($_[0]) || $_[0]);
}
## the functions ...
sub does_role {
my ($class_or_obj, $role) = @_;
my $meta = find_meta($class_or_obj);
return unless defined $meta;
return unless $meta->can('does_role');
return 1 if $meta->does_role($role);
return;
}
sub search_class_by_role {
my ($class_or_obj, $role_name) = @_;
my $meta = find_meta($class_or_obj);
return unless defined $meta;
foreach my $class ($meta->class_precedence_list) {
my $_meta = find_meta($class);
next unless defined $_meta;
foreach my $role (@{ $_meta->roles || [] }) {
return $class if $role->name eq $role_name;
}
}
return;
}
sub apply_all_roles {
my $applicant = shift;
confess "Must specify at least one role to apply to $applicant" unless @_;
my $roles = Data::OptList::mkopt([ @_ ]);
#use Data::Dumper;
#warn Dumper $roles;
my $meta = (blessed $applicant ? $applicant : find_meta($applicant));
foreach my $role_spec (@$roles) {
Class::MOP::load_class($role_spec->[0]);
}
($_->[0]->can('meta') && $_->[0]->meta->isa('Moose::Meta::Role'))
|| confess "You can only consume roles, " . $_->[0] . " is not a Moose role"
foreach @$roles;
if (scalar @$roles == 1) {
my ($role, $params) = @{$roles->[0]};
$role->meta->apply($meta, (defined $params ? %$params : ()));
}
else {
Moose::Meta::Role->combine(
@$roles
)->apply($meta);
}
}
# instance deconstruction ...
sub get_all_attribute_values {
my ($class, $instance) = @_;
return +{
map { $_->name => $_->get_value($instance) }
grep { $_->has_value($instance) }
$class->compute_all_applicable_attributes
};
}
sub get_all_init_args {
my ($class, $instance) = @_;
return +{
map { $_->init_arg => $_->get_value($instance) }
grep { $_->has_value($instance) }
grep { defined($_->init_arg) }
$class->compute_all_applicable_attributes
};
}
sub resolve_metatrait_alias {
resolve_metaclass_alias( @_, trait => 1 );
}
sub resolve_metaclass_alias {
my ( $type, $metaclass_name, %options ) = @_;
if ( my $resolved = eval {
my $possible_full_name = 'Moose::Meta::' . $type . '::Custom::' . ( $options{trait} ? "Trait::" : "" ) . $metaclass_name;
Class::MOP::load_class($possible_full_name);
$possible_full_name->can('register_implementation')
? $possible_full_name->register_implementation
: $possible_full_name;
} ) {
return $resolved;
} else {
Class::MOP::load_class($metaclass_name);
return $metaclass_name;
}
}
sub add_method_modifier {
my ( $class_or_obj, $modifier_name, $args ) = @_;
my $meta = find_meta($class_or_obj);
my $code = pop @{$args};
my $add_modifier_method = 'add_' . $modifier_name . '_method_modifier';
if ( my $method_modifier_type = ref( @{$args}[0] ) ) {
if ( $method_modifier_type eq 'Regexp' ) {
my @all_methods = $meta->compute_all_applicable_methods;
my @matched_methods
= grep { $_->{name} =~ @{$args}[0] } @all_methods;
$meta->$add_modifier_method( $_->{name}, $code )
for @matched_methods;
}
}
else {
$meta->$add_modifier_method( $_, $code ) for @{$args};
}
}
1;

=head1 NAME
Moose::Util - Utilities for working with Moose classes
=head1 SYNOPSIS
use Moose::Util qw/find_meta does_role search_class_by_role/;
my $meta = find_meta($object) || die "No metaclass found";
if (does_role($object, $role)) {
print "The object can do $role!\n";
}
my $class = search_class_by_role($object, 'FooRole');
print "Nearest class with 'FooRole' is $class\n";
=head1 DESCRIPTION
This is a set of utility functions to help working with Moose classes, and
is used internally by Moose itself. The goal is to provide useful functions
that for both Moose users and Moose extenders (MooseX:: authors).
This is a relatively new addition to the Moose toolchest, so ideas,
suggestions and contributions to this collection are most welcome.
See the L<TODO> section below for a list of ideas for possible functions
to write.
=head1 EXPORTED FUNCTIONS
=over 4
=item B<find_meta ($class_or_obj)>
This will attempt to locate a metaclass for the given C<$class_or_obj>
and return it.
=item B<does_role ($class_or_obj, $role_name)>
Returns true if C<$class_or_obj> can do the role C<$role_name>.
=item B<search_class_by_role ($class_or_obj, $role_name)>
Returns first class in precedence list that consumed C<$role_name>.
=item B<apply_all_roles ($applicant, @roles)>
Given an C<$applicant> (which can somehow be turned into either a
metaclass or a metarole) and a list of C<@roles> this will do the
right thing to apply the C<@roles> to the C<$applicant>. This is
actually used internally by both L<Moose> and L<Moose::Role>, and the
C<@roles> will be pre-processed through L<Data::OptList::mkopt>
to allow for the additional arguments to be passed.
=item B<get_all_attribute_values($meta, $instance)>
Returns the values of the C<$instance>'s fields keyed by the attribute names.
=item B<get_all_init_args($meta, $instance)>
Returns a hash reference where the keys are all the attributes' C<init_arg>s
and the values are the instance's fields. Attributes without an C<init_arg>
will be skipped.
=item B<resolve_metaclass_alias($category, $name, %options)>
=item B<resolve_metatrait_alias($category, $name, %options)>
Resolve a short name like in e.g.
has foo => (
metaclass => "Bar",
);
to a full class name.
